From: [identity profile] geckochan.livejournal.com
39, 31.5 and 41.5, to be precise, at this exact moment. And 5'7. Another of those 'inbetween' sizes. I do definitely think it's a good idea to put a few little adjustable touches to your costumes wherever possible, since everybodies bodies are so unique, and if anyone else if like me, they fluctuate an inch or 2 every now and then. Elastic in part of a skirt is one way, ties in cute bows at the back are another, and shirring can help make shirt and dresses nice and fitted even if there's an inch or 2 difference in people. I'm sure lots of people will appreciate the chance to custom order for their measurements too.
